Daily Express YouTube channel alternates between live coverage of aircraft activity at RAF Fairford and events in Tehran

That's my take.

B-1 and B-52 bombers from various Air Force bases in the continental United States are currently operating out of the RAF Fairford air base near Swindon, England. A motorway runs right past the end of the runway, and planespotters by the dozen have set up cameras to monitor activity.

Weather recently at Fairford has been so dreary that three B-1s had to divert to Ramstein, Germany. That wasn't enough to keep the planespotters away. I don't think there's a time when at least one is not on duty. The skies are clear today.

If nothing's going on at RAF Fairford, the channel switches over to a feed from downtown Tehran. If guess that's Tehran. I can't imagine what else it would be. Smoke is rising from something.

This is not an endorsement of the war, just a look at how it's being carried out.
